Training Specialist

Augusta, Georgia Government

Training Specialist delivering workforce training for Georgia Quick Start manufacturing projects. Developing instructional materials, assessing needs, and building training devices at the Cartersville center.

About the role

Key responsibilities & impact
  • Provide training services for Quick Start projects
  • Learn and support all areas of departmental operations under broad supervision of the Director
  • Assist with training operations
  • Perform training needs assessments
  • Develop training materials and deliver instruction
  • Design and build training devices
  • Work with the Director and staff to evaluate and standardize business processes and tools
  • Assist the Director with special projects
  • Prepare operations reports
  • Conduct training research
  • Travel extensively within northern Georgia and occasionally outside Georgia and the US

Requirements

What you’ll need
  • Bachelor’s degree and one (1) year of experience planning, developing, delivering or evaluating training programs or academic instruction, or four (4) years of experience delivering training including developing instructional materials and lesson plans
  • Associates degree in a related field and three (3) years of related work experience
  • Experience may substitute for the degree on a year-for-year basis
  • Preferred: Bachelor’s or advanced degree in management, instructional technology, industrial technologies or a related field and 3 years’ experience in a manufacturing training environment
  • Preferred experience with instructional design methodology for manufacturing and large-scale distribution process training
  • Preferred experience conducting training analysis and task analysis
  • Preferred data entry experience, including updating schedules within an interactive management system
  • Preferred experience configuring training material packages and presenting technical training classes
  • Preferred experience designing and building high-functioning training simulators and devices
  • Preferred experience with operation of multi-site training centers
  • Preferred experience working with training information management systems
